What is Long Term Care? Commonly referred to as LTC

Long term care in Frederick is not necessarily medical care but rather "custodial care" that involves providing an individual with assistance in the activities of routine daily living, or the supervision of someone who is cognitively impaired. LTC or long term care insurance in Frederick has been around in one form or another since the early days of Medicare, but the policies of years ago bear little resemblance to today's policies. Frederick long term care covers a range of medical and support services for people with degenerative conditions such as Parkinson's disease, or conditions resulting from a stroke, or a prolonged illness like cancer or a cognitive disorder such as Alzheimer's. While an early (LTC) long term care policy resembled a basic Medicare supplement policy, Frederick long term care insurance present day has evolved and typically covers a wide range of services to include: Frederick assisted living facilities, Frederick nursing home care, and Frederick adult day care.

What Do Frederick Long Term Care Services Cost?

Compare adult long term care to that of a parent with a new born baby. Daily activities related to the care of an adult are even more intensified and as a result, become very expensive. Frederick long term care services are very expensive. The reason being, most people take for granted the daily activities we perform ourselves most of our life. Getting out of bed, going to the bathroom, showing or bathing, fixing meals etc. Quality Frederick nursing homes are always filled to capacity and consequently, have no problem charging higher fees for their services. One (1) year in a Frederick nursing home now averages $50,000-$100,000 annually and in some parts of the country even more!

Who Should Consider Frederick Long Term Care Insurance?

While financial planners often refer to long term care insurance as a form of "asset protection", most individuals will need to have assets worth protecting to justify paying policy premiums. Like most insurance products, long term care insurance allows the insured to pay an affordable premium to protect against the costs of an unaffordable medical event that could produce tens of thousands or more in hospital or post care costs. Eventually Medicaid pays for long term care services once an individual is unable to pay. In other words, if you can pay long term care insurance premiums without altering your lifestyle too much, you should consider transferring the risk to an insurance company who will then cover the extended medical care services you might require while your own assets are protected.

How To Shop A Good Frederick Long Term Care Insurance Policy

Financial Strength - Because many policyholders will not utilize benefits from their long term care policy for 10 to 20 years after issue, you must be certain to purchase your policy from a (LTC) long term care company with strong financial history and backing. So financial strength of the carrier should be one element in your reviewing long term care companies. As discussed above, Frederick long term care services can be very expensive. Hiring someone (part-time) to assist in-home could easily cost $130 per day in Frederick, while some parts of the country it could easily exceed $200+ per day. Be aware of the costs in Frederick when selecting a daily benefit. Find the average cost in Frederick using our online quote page.
Claims - What are the carriers claims process? What percentage of claims submitted are actually paid?
Stable Premiums - Long term care companies have the right to raise their premiums for a "class" of policyholders.
Comprehensive Coverage - Know in advance "where" you can and cannot be to receive benefits. (e.g. nursing home, in-home care, adult day care) Inflation Protection - Obviously today's costs will not be tomorrows costs. Does your policy allow for benefit increases over time?
